When Your Monitor Is a True Sound-Void: External Speakers

So, your monitor has absolutely no audio inputs. Zilch. Nada. It’s a visual-only device, like a fancy picture frame. In this scenario, the monitor itself is irrelevant to the audio signal. You’re not adding audio *to* the monitor; you’re just adding speakers *to your setup* that happen to be near your monitor. This is, in my opinion, the most common and sensible solution if your monitor is truly speaker-less. Why? Because built-in monitor speakers are often mediocre at best. The key here is understanding that the monitor itself isn’t the audio device; your PC or whatever source you’re using is, and the speakers are just the output. This is why I think the advice to ‘wire speakers *to your monitor*’ is sometimes misleading.

You’ll need a pair of powered speakers. These have their own amplifier and plug directly into your computer’s audio output. Standard 3.5mm jack connection works here, just like the previous example, but instead of plugging into the monitor, it goes directly into your PC. If you want a cleaner setup, look for Bluetooth speakers. They connect wirelessly, which is a godsend for desk clutter. Just pair them with your computer, and you’re done. No extra cables running between your PC and your monitor, and no worrying about whether your monitor can even accept an audio signal. It’s a clean separation of concerns: monitor for visuals, speakers for sound.

The Middle Ground: HDMI and Displayport Audio

This is where things get a bit more modern, and honestly, cleaner. If your monitor and your graphics card (or laptop) both support HDMI or DisplayPort, you might already have audio capabilities built into your display cable. HDMI, in particular, is designed to carry both video and audio signals simultaneously. DisplayPort also supports audio, though it’s a bit less common for it to be routed to built-in monitor speakers compared to HDMI. The trick is that your computer needs to be set up to send audio over that specific port.

I remember the first time I hooked up a new gaming monitor via HDMI. Suddenly, I had sound coming from the monitor’s tiny, barely audible speakers. I was confused. My PC’s audio output was still plugged into my old speakers. Turns out, when you connect via HDMI, Windows (or macOS, or Linux) often defaults to treating the monitor as a new audio output device. You have to go into your sound settings and select your monitor as the default playback device if you want the audio to route that way. It’s not complicated, but it’s a setting most people don’t even think to look for.

To make this work, you need to: 1. Ensure both your graphics card/motherboard and your monitor have HDMI or DisplayPort ports. 2. Use an HDMI or DisplayPort cable. 3. Go into your operating system’s sound settings and select your monitor as the audio output device. If you’re using DisplayPort and don’t get audio, double-check your monitor’s manual; some DisplayPort implementations don’t carry audio by default or require specific settings. This is a fantastic method if your monitor has decent built-in speakers because it keeps your desk free of extra audio cables. However, if your monitor’s speakers are weak, this method won’t magically make them better, and you’d still be better off with external speakers.

What About USB Soundbars or Adapters?

Sometimes, you’re in a situation where you can’t easily run cables from your PC, or perhaps your PC has limited audio outputs. This is where USB audio devices come in handy. For monitors without speakers, you can get small USB soundbars that attach directly to the monitor, or you can use a USB audio adapter. Think of a USB soundbar as a compact, self-powered speaker designed specifically to pair with your display. (See Also: How To Switch An Acer Monitor To Hdmi )

I once had a client who insisted on a completely wireless setup for aesthetic reasons. Their monitor had no audio inputs, and they hated the look of cables snaking across their minimalist desk. We ended up using a USB soundbar that clipped right onto the top of their monitor. It drew power from the USB port and sent audio through the same cable. It was surprisingly effective for casual listening, though audiophiles would probably scoff. For someone who just needs to hear system alerts or the occasional background podcast while they work, it was a perfect, clean solution.

A USB audio adapter is essentially a tiny external sound card. You plug it into a USB port on your computer, and it gives you a 3.5mm audio output jack. This is great if your computer’s built-in audio jack is faulty or inaccessible, or if you want to use your existing wired headphones or speakers but your computer is lacking the right ports. It’s a straightforward way to add audio capability without digging into internal components. The quality will vary wildly depending on the adapter, so read reviews. Can I Use My Headphones with a Monitor That Has No Audio Output?

Generally, no. If your monitor doesn’t have a headphone jack or any other audio output port, it cannot directly send an audio signal to headphones. You would need to plug your headphones into your computer or another audio source device. (See Also: How To Monitor My Sleep With Apple Watch )

Do All Monitors with HDMI Ports Have Speakers?

No, not all monitors with HDMI ports have built-in speakers. HDMI is capable of transmitting audio signals, but whether or not a monitor includes speakers is a hardware design choice by the manufacturer. Always check the monitor’s specifications to confirm if it has speakers.

What’s the Difference Between Monitor Audio Input and Output?

An audio input port on a monitor is where you would send an audio signal *to* the monitor, usually for its built-in speakers. An audio output port (less common on monitors) would be used to send an audio signal *from* the monitor to external speakers or headphones, which isn’t the primary function of most displays.

How Can I Get Sound If My Monitor Doesn’t Have Speakers and My Computer Has No Audio Jack?

If your computer lacks an audio jack, your best bet is to use a USB audio adapter or a Bluetooth connection for speakers or headphones. This bypasses the need for a traditional audio port on your computer.
